Texas State University Ranks Low in National Campus Free Speech Index
Texas State University ranks near the bottom nationally for campus free speech, according to Axios.

Austin, TX, September 17, 2026 —
Texas State University has been ranked among the lowest institutions nationally for campus free speech, according to a recent report by Axios. The findings place the university in a concerning position regarding its commitment to and protection of free expression for its students and faculty.
